I forgot to follow-up yesterday. It seems like my issue was caused by a bug with the pg_qualstats extension that I was using in conjuction with the POWA extension. There was already a similar issue reported on their tracker at https://github.com/powa-team/powa/issues/104
It seems that high TPS stress testing on Wednesday afternoon triggered the bug. When the stress testing tailed off, the error messages stopped happening and I was able to run pg_dump without errors. I removed those extensions shortly after. The authors have put out a bug fix but I can't use this system to test their fix and my sandbox isn't available for the same HA server stress test that we were doing on Wednesday.
